[The Council will convene via ZOOM CONFERENCE at 5:15 p.m. and it is expected they will adjourn into a teleconference Executive Session at 5:16 p.m. to discuss attorney-client privileged matters, personnel matters and legal matters]
Roll Call
Additional Item
Isaias Storm Recovery and Coronavirus Update.
Draft unapproved minutes of the Regular Meeting of the City Council held July 15, 2020.
Discussion to determine if “Purchase Plaza” street closures will extend beyond the previously set date (originally August 9, 2020).
Continue the public hearing to amend chapter § 191-38 “Parking in Metered Zones” to extend all metered parking zones until 9:00 PM Monday – Saturday.
Presentation on 2019 City financials by the auditing firm of BST & Co, LLP.
Update on disposition of donated boat.
Presentation by City Deputy Comptroller of the City’s current financial position.
Presentation regarding the Capital Improvement Program (CIP) for 2021.
Adoption of the 2020/2021 tax levy and tax rate for the Rye Neck Union Free School District. Roll Call.
Authorize the Interim City Manager to sign an agreement with Suez Water Westchester, already approved by the Public Service Commission, to provide water usage data by property.
Authorization for the City Manager to sell at auction surplus equipment as listed by the Boat Basin.
Consideration of a request from the Rye Free Reading Room to use the Village Green on Sunday, September 20 from 12 pm to 5 pm to host the Rye Free Reading Room Book Sale, a fundraiser for the Rye Free Reading Room.
Consideration of a request from The Rye Free Reading Room to use of the Village Green to offer Wiggle Giggle with Dawny Dew, a popular children’s program (usually held indoors) on September 2, 9, 16, 23, and 30, and October, 7 and 14. The program begins at 9:30, and repeats at 10:15 and 11 am. Each of the three sessions runs for 20 minutes.
Appointments to Boards and Commissions by the Mayor with Council approval.
17. Old Business/New Business. 18. Adjournment
